Claude vs Gemini
At mid-2026, Claude (Opus 4.8) leads for deep reasoning and coding reliability, while Gemini (3.5 Flash/Pro) dominates on multimodal breadth and Google ecosystem integration, there's no single winner, only the right tool for each job.
The context
The Claude vs Gemini debate is heating up in mid-2026 as both AI families have released major updates. Claude’s Opus 4.8 and Sonnet 4.6 focus on code quality, agentic reasoning, and safety, while Gemini’s 3.5 Flash/Pro push speed, scale, and native multimodal generation (image, video, music) with deep Google Search grounding. Users are comparing them for coding, studying, content creation, and enterprise workflows, often leaving ChatGPT as a distant third. The trend reflects a maturing market where differentiation matters more than raw benchmarks, and each platform has carved distinct strengths.
